Kidnapped businessman Ranga Gova in Zimbabwe after being found

The 35-year-old businessman was kidnapped while driving his wife's car last month.


Well-known Gauteng businessman Ranga Gova, who was kidnapped on 3 November, has been found and reunited with his family.

Gova went home to Zimbabwe on Saturday, Olifantsfontein police station investigating officer Captain Seckle confirmed to Pretoria Rekord.

Seckle could not, however, disclose where Gova had been found.

“Gova was found but he’s not in the country at the moment, he went back to Zimbabwe,” said Seckle.

The 35-year-old businessman was kidnapped while driving his wife’s car after being stopped at traffic lights minutes from his residential estate in Midstream, Centurion.

She suspected the kidnapping was linked to his fuel business, Ranga’s wife, Mamelo Mareko, told Pretoria Rekord in November.

She said he was returning home from a golf course where he had coffee when he was taken.

Police found the grey Mercedes-Benz Gova had been driving two days after his disappearance.

The couple have been together for almost six years and have a two-year-old daughter.
